
Roadrunners Double-Up Colts, 12-6
May 29, 2013 - United League Baseball (ULB)
San Angelo Colts News Release
San Angelo, Texas --- Despite committing a game-high seven errors, the Edinburg Roadrunners defeated the Colts, 12-6, Wednesday night at Foster Field.
Edinburg jumped out to an early lead and never looked back. The Roadrunners scored three runs in the first, and then four more in the second inning. In the second, Edinburg had back-to-back home runs. Centerfielder Robert Rinard crushed a three-run homer into left-centerfield, and third baseman Bunyu Maeda followed with a solo shot.
San Angelo scored a pair of runs in the bottom of the first inning when designated hitter Kyle Nichols smashed a two-RBI homer that scored third baseman Steve Rinaudo. It was Nichols's first home run of the year.
The Roadrunners led 7-2 after just two innings, and then took a commanding 10-2 lead after the fourth. Edinburg scored two more runs to ahead 12-2 by the end of the eighth.
The Colts rallied for four unearned runs in the ninth, courtesy of four Edinburg errors, but it was not enough to overcome their large deficit.
Roadrunners' starter Drew Coffey (1-1) earned the win, surrendering two unearned runs on seven hits in five innings of work. Meanwhile, Colts' starter Frank James (0-1) lasted just three innings, giving up seven runs, four earned, on six hits for the loss.
The loss drops the Colts to 3-3, while the Roadrunners improve to 2-4 with their second straight win. Game three of this four-game series is Thursday night at Foster Field.
